Story summary
AI agents — autonomous, task-focused AI that can read systems, take actions, and follow rules — are no longer experimental. Over the last 18–24 months we’ve seen fast adoption of agent-based tools that connect to CRMs, ticketing systems, databases, and calendars to automate sales tasks, reporting, and routine operations. These agents use retrieval-augmented generation (RAG), real-time connectors, and simple guardrails to deliver practical business outcomes: faster lead qualification, automated monthly reports, and 24/7 customer triage.

Why this matters for your business

  • Faster, cheaper execution: Agents reduce manual handoffs and repetitive work, cutting cost per task.
  • Better sales velocity: Automated lead scoring, outreach sequencing, and follow-up keep pipelines moving.
  • Cleaner, current reporting: Agents can generate up-to-date dashboards and natural-language summaries from your data.
  • Scalable operations: You can deploy agents to handle common processes without hiring more headcount.

RocketSales insight — practical steps you can take now
Here’s how your business can use AI agents without risking data quality or compliance:

  1. Start with the right process

    • Pick one high-impact, repeatable process (e.g., lead qualification, monthly revenue reporting, or first-level support).
    • Map inputs, outputs, and success metrics before touching models.
  2. Use hybrid design: humans + agents

    • Let agents handle routine steps (data prep, summary, suggested actions) and route exceptions to humans.
    • This reduces errors and builds trust while keeping speed benefits.
  3. Connect data securely

    • Use vetted connectors and vector stores for RAG so agents reference current, auditable source material.
    • Enforce role-based access and logging for compliance.
  4. Pilot fast, measure clearly

    • Run a 6–8 week pilot with a small user group.
    • Track time saved, error rates, conversion lift, and reporting accuracy.
  5. Optimize and scale

    • Tune prompts, retrain on company docs, and add guardrails.
    • Standardize deployment templates so new agents roll out quickly across teams.
